CONTEXT
The Humanitarian Hub is a consortium of NGOs currently led by Médecins du Monde, the Belgian Red Cross, and the Citizen Platform for Refugee Support. The project was launched in September 2017 to address the growing needs of migrants in particularly vulnerable situations. Each organization pursues complementary objectives to meet the needs of people experiencing homelessness in Brussels, providing them with access to essential multidisciplinary services, tailored support, and guidance.
THE ESSENTIAL
As a Security and Prevention Officer, you are the first contact that beneficiaries have with the Hub.
Your main objective is to ensure that the security rules and flow management of the Humanitarian Hub are properly implemented, as defined by the coordination team.
MAIN TASKS AND RESPONSIBILITIES
As a safety and prevention officer :
Ensuring that the crowd management system is in place and helping to ensure that ticket distribution runs smoothly.
Ensuring the day-to-day organisation and management of the flow and movement of beneficiaries, in collaboration with the departments and coordinators concerned (including opening times, specific organisation for meal queues, closing times, etc.);
Providing front-line reception, information and guidance to Hub users. Observe and monitor access routes to the Hub.
Implementing and ensuring the application of all joint safety and security rules and protocols within the Hub;
Facilitating relations between beneficiaries and the various Hub departments:
Providing quality and culturally sensitive interpretation between Hub service providers and the beneficiary (trialogue) in the beneficiary's mother tongue or other language understood by the beneficiary, supporting intercultural awareness, sensitivity and clarity of communication between the parties and prevention/security management ;
To assist service providers and beneficiaries in addressing the negative consequences of socio-cultural differences by acting as a cultural broker; to identify and report on barriers to fair and equal access to services.
In collaboration with relevant members of the project team, provide information to beneficiaries on the use of the healthcare system and other support services (shelter, food, transport, legal support) provided by the Hub and other actors, with the aim of fostering beneficiaries' empowerment and autonomy.
As a member of the HUB's security team :
Informing the Security and Prevention Manager of potential tensions and helping to de-escalate tensions.
Alerting the Security & Prevention Manager and/or the coordination team to threats to personal safety and/or incidents.
Ensuring that the framework is properly understood by the teams and beneficiaries.
Making regular rounds of the various premises throughout the working day.
